Stuffing & De Stuffing
The stuffing and destuffing of containers are vital processes in the logistics industry. The process involves meticulous planning to ensure safe transportation and efficient space utilization. This process also requires special tools and expertise to ensure the safety of every piece of cargo. Stuffing is the process of putting, stacking and securing cargo within a container prior to transport by road, rail or sea. The process of securing involves ensuring that the weight is distributed properly, filling gaps with dunnage or wood, and using straps to secure pallets as well as individual items. It is also important to balance the weight both vertically and horizontally to prevent shifting. This may seem easy but it's a Tetris game.
